Understanding Rooflights and Their Energy Advantages?

Skylights, commonly referred to as rooflights, are architectural installations created to let natural light flow into interior spaces. These features can significantly improve energy efficiency in both residential and commercial settings by minimizing reliance on artificial lighting throughout the day. By maximizing the use of natural light, rooflights help lower electricity consumption, which can lead to decreased energy bills.

Moreover, contemporary skylight systems frequently integrate advanced glazing solutions that deliver better thermal performance. Such insulation serves to stabilize internal temperatures, limiting reliance on heating and air conditioning. As such, inhabitants are likely to notice better comfort levels while simultaneously decreasing energy costs.

In addition, thoughtfully situated rooflights can boost ventilation, providing better air circulation. This not only supports a more wholesome indoor environment but can also decrease the reliance on mechanical ventilation systems. Ultimately, rooflights provide a wide-ranging approach to improving energy efficiency in a wide range of building types.

Picking the Ideal Rooflight for Your Home or Office

When selecting a rooflight for a house or workplace, several factors must be considered to guarantee maximum efficiency and appearance. The dimensions and positioning of the rooflight are crucial, as they influence both illumination and aesthetics. Identifying the correct glazing option is also essential; choices include dual or triple-pane units that deliver enhanced thermal insulation and energy savings.

Moreover, the design should complement the architectural character of the property, whether modern or traditional. Ventilation capabilities are another key consideration, as they can aid in controlling interior temperatures and air quality.

Ultimately, evaluating local planning permissions and any required building regulations is crucial to guarantee compliance. By analyzing these factors, homeowners can reach educated choices that elevate both the functionality and beauty of their properties while optimizing energy efficiency.

How Rooflights Improve Temperature Control and Insulation

When integrated into a structure's design, rooflights greatly improve temperature regulation and insulation. These architectural features allow natural light to penetrate while limiting heat loss during the winter months. Rooflights are available with sophisticated glazing systems that reflect unwanted solar heat in summer, thereby reducing reliance on air conditioning. This capability not only enhances comfort but also contributes to a more stable internal environment.

Furthermore, rooflights support passive solar heating, collecting sunlight to heat areas in a natural way. This can result in a significant reduction in heating costs. The careful positioning of rooflights can generate a balanced distribution of light and warmth, reducing cold spots and draughts inside a room.

In addition, premium insulation around rooflight installations is crucial. Effectively insulated rooflights prevent thermal bridging, so that energy efficiency is enhanced. Ultimately, rooflights serve as a critical element in improving a building's related content energy performance and comfort levels.

Is It Possible to Install Rooflights on Every Type of Roof?

Rooflights are suitable for installation on a range of roof types, including pitched, flat, and vaulted roofs. That said, particular factors regarding local building regulations, structural integrity, and waterproofing should be carefully considered to secure proper installation and performance.

Do Rooflights Require Special Maintenance?

Rooflights typically need very little maintenance, such as periodic cleaning and examination for any leaks or damage. Keeping seals secure and tackling any concerns without delay can assist in sustaining their effectiveness and durability over time.

Which Building Regulations Are Relevant to Rooflight Installations?

Building regulations for rooflight installations commonly cover compliance with fire safety, structural integrity, and thermal performance requirements. Municipal planning departments might further apply constraints, ensuring the installations enhance safety and align with zoning requirements.
